“Ülgen is the son of Kayra and Umay and is the god of goodness.”

“While Tengrism includes the worship of personified gods (tngri) such as Ülgen and Kayra, Tengri per se is considered an 'abstract phenomenon'.”

“Erlik is a brother of Ülgen, they both have been created from Kayra (Tengere Kayra Khan) the god of it.”

“Ülgen was ordered to throw Erlik and his servants out of the sky. A battle occurred and Erlik was injured and cast into the underworld”
